Skip to content
On this page

定义并调用无参方法

方法是一种可重复使用的代码块,它可以接受零个或多个参数,并返回一个值(如果需要的话)。带参方法是指可以接受一个或多个参数的方法。

在 C# 中,无参方法是一种不带任何参数的方法。它们被声明在类中,可以被其他方法或类调用。无参方法可以执行各种操作,例如计算数字、操作字符串、读取或写入文件等。

csharp
public class MyClass
{
    /// <summary>
    /// 定义一个无参方法
    /// </summary>
    public void MyMethod()
    {
        Console.WriteLine("Hello, world!"); // 在控制台上打印一条消息
    }
}

class Program
{
    static void Main(string[] args)
    {
        MyClass myObj = new MyClass(); // 创建 MyClass 类的一个实例
        myObj.MyMethod(); // 调用 MyClass 类中的 MyMethod() 方法
    }
}
  • MyMethod() 是一个无参方法,它被定义在 MyClass 类中。
  • 在 Main() 方法中,我们创建了 MyClass 的一个实例,并使用它来调用 MyMethod() 方法。
  • 当程序运行时,它会输出 "Hello, world!" 到控制台。

注意

  • 在调用一个无参方法时,括号 () 是必需的,即使它不带任何参数。
  • 这是因为括号告诉编译器你想要调用一个方法而不是访问一个属性或字段。
  • 如果你不包括括号,编译器会认为你只是在引用一个成员而不是调用一个方法。